Last November I became a member of Bethlehem Baptist Church (BBC) in Minneapolis, Minnesota. Through my church I have been offered an opportunity to teach English in Prague beginning in July, 2009. I will work with The Evangelical Alliance Mission (TEAM) and a family from my church that has been in the Czech Republic for 13 years and has helped start three churches there.

I will serve at a church in Prague’s Skalka neighborhood that has a large English language outreach program. Right now there are 105 students in 11 classes. Each class includes one and a half hours of English instruction and half an hour of Bible study.

As a teacher I hope to help spread the Gospel of the new life that comes from a saving relationship with Jesus Christ. This joyful news will be especially sweet to the Czech people whose religious freedom was suppressed under communism until 1989. The C.B. Skalka Church is the only church available to the 22,000 residents of the Skalka neighborhood.
